Nope, nothing but outliers and feats that require more context than anything else. All of these were heavily circumstantial.

Like his fights with Quantum, Miles needed help from Iron Man to weaken Quantum's powers so that Miles can knock him out, second round Miles hit his weak spot, and third Miles instead talked Quantum down. Under no circumstances in the context did it say that Miles matched Quantum in terms of power.

Miles stealing Ares' axe was tactical move, not a power move and therefore in no way does that put him on par with Ares. This was a simply precise, tactical move, not a contest of speed. It's heavily implied that Ares was holding back his true strength.

The shield that Captain America broke wasn't the same shield that Cap used to defend against Hercules. That was a weaker version entirely, and it was already damaged to begin with.

That black hole? Miles was barely hanging on and he was nearly sucked inside it if Shuri didn't deactivate as the black hole was created by unstable gravity gloves. Again, context, Miles doesn't have black hole singularity strength, he was barely holding on and nearly died.

Defeating Doctor Doom would be very impressive....if it weren't for the fact that this is the Doctor Doom from Miles' universe, Earth-1610, who is nowhere near Doctor Doom's level of power from Earth-616, not even half of it.

Defeating Zip Zephyr is also not impressive as the best we've seen the demigod do is destroy some SWAT vans and some large buildings. He's only a city-scale level threat and nowhere near any of the dangerous threats that Deku has faced routinely.

And it goes without saying, that Miles' fight with Blackheart is nothing but an outlier as it's shown that he's been routinely fatally damaged by street-tier villains like Rabble. It's just lazy writing and at best, you can say that Miles' Venom Blast just has a significant effect on demons.

Again, context matters the most. All these "feats" are just outliers and things that don't show the full picture. Miles is just City Level at best and there's no way he beats Deku.
